Motors on show for Mania event

The sun shone brightly for fans of a Motormania weekend in South Holland.

A parade of cars and bikes went through Holbeach and Fleet on Saturday afternoon when around 30 vehicles took to the roads to promote Sunday’s event.

Cars and motorcycles from a bygone era were at their gleaming best for the show which was held at the Lawns and Lakes campsite in Fleet.
There were prizes for the best in show, a VW Beetle, the best classic was a Mini van and best modified vehicle was a Mini.
“There were well over 300 vehicles on display and lots of other things for visitors to enjoy throughout the day,” said Isobel Hutchinson, of organisers Holbeach Community First.
Initial plans are already being laid for next year’s event.
“We would like to thank all our volunteers who did a brilliant job of stewarding on the day, and the air cadets for managing the visitor parking for us,” she said.
“We are now recuperating from a busy weekend and will be starting to plan next year’s event in the coming months,” added Isobel.
